the Story of Chickie MacPhee

For a period of time in the late 1980s, Cape Breton’s Chickie Macphee became one of his island’s most famous and most beloved residents. His notoriety didn’t begin with any great feat, show of skill, or significant act of generosity. Chickie Macphee was just a regular Cape Bretoner with a bit of a drinking problem and a love for Karaoke.

In this episode, we will explore his unique legacy.

Our guest, Chickie Macphee’s brother Rich MacPhee, will tell us how Chickie ended up famous for getting drunk and singing ‘wild thing’ on the community TV channel.
